Sha256: 0641aa11491a412b9ff5b9b366875dd7c661946e15f5bace02ae8a7409aa17f0

Contents?: true

Size: 918 Bytes

Versions: 8

Compression:

Stored size: 918 Bytes

Contents

class HeadstartMailer

  def self.deliver_change_password(user)
    if MadMimiMailer.api_settings.present? && MadMimiMailer.api_settings[:username].present? && MadMimiMailer.api_settings[:api_key].present?
      MimiMailer.deliver_mimi_change_password(user)
    else
      GenericMailer.deliver_change_password(user)
    end
  end
  
  def self.deliver_welcome(user)
    if MadMimiMailer.api_settings.present? && MadMimiMailer.api_settings[:username].present? && MadMimiMailer.api_settings[:api_key].present?
      MimiMailer.deliver_welcome(user)
    else
      GenericMailer.deliver_welcome(user)
    end
  end
  
  def self.deliver_confirmation(user)
    if MadMimiMailer.api_settings.present? && MadMimiMailer.api_settings[:username].present? && MadMimiMailer.api_settings[:api_key].present?
      MimiMailer.deliver_confirmation(user)
    else
      GenericMailer.deliver_confirmation(user)
    end
  end
  

end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
headstart-0.5.2 app/models/headstart_mailer.rb
headstart-0.5.1 app/models/headstart_mailer.rb
headstart-0.5.0 app/models/headstart_mailer.rb
headstart-0.4.2 app/models/headstart_mailer.rb
headstart-0.4.1 app/models/headstart_mailer.rb
headstart-0.4.0 app/models/headstart_mailer.rb
headstart-0.3.0 app/models/headstart_mailer.rb
headstart-0.1.0 app/models/headstart_mailer.rb